Weather warnings and advisories to take note of on Monday, 21 October 2024

Based on the latest forecast from the South African Weather Service (SAWS), here are the key weather warnings and advisories for Monday, 21 October 2024:

  • Orange Warning Level 6: Disruptive rainfall expected between Port Alfred and Richards Bay, causing flooding, road closures, and infrastructure damage.
  • Yellow Warning Level 4: Severe thunderstorms forecasted for KwaZulu-Natal, southern-western Mpumalanga, Gauteng, Free State, North West, and northeastern Northern Cape, potentially causing damage to property, vehicles, and infrastructure.
  • Yellow Warning Level 4: Disruptive rain in the Eastern Cape regions, including Nelson Mandela Bay, Kouga, and Sundays River Valley, leading to localized flooding.
  • Fire Danger: Extremely high fire danger conditions over northeastern Northern Cape, parts of North West, and northern Limpopo.

Cape Town, Durban and Johannesburg forecast: Here’s what to expect on Monday, 21 October 2024

Cape Town

On Monday, Cape Town will experience sunny conditions with temperatures ranging between 13°C in the morning and a high of 23°C in the afternoon. Winds will blow from the southeast at about 24 km/h, and there is no expected rainfall. The day will be clear with a moderate breeze, making it a pleasant day overall for outdoor activities.

Durban

Durban will experience heavy rain throughout the day, with temperatures ranging between 17°C and 19°C. Winds will be strong, coming from the southeast at 41 km/h, with 100% cloud cover. Be prepared for wet conditions as the rainfall is expected to be significant, making it a stormy day overall​.

Johannesburg

Johannesburg will experience mostly overcast skies with temperatures ranging from 16°C in the early morning to a high of 24°C in the afternoon. There is a 30% chance of light rain, particularly in the morning and evening. Winds will be moderate, coming from the north at speeds of up to 39 km/h​.

  • Gauteng: Cloudy, cool to warm, scattered showers and thundershowers, widespread in the south.
  • Mpumalanga: Cloudy, cool with scattered showers and thundershowers, warm in the Lowveld.
  • Limpopo: Cloudy, cool to warm, isolated showers and thundershowers in the south; hot in the west.
  • North West Province: Cloudy, windy, warm to hot with scattered showers and thundershowers.
  • Free State: Cloudy, windy, cool to warm, widespread showers and thundershowers, cold in the east.
  • Northern Cape: Fine in the west, partly cloudy, windy, cool to warm, isolated showers in the east and south.
  • Western Cape: Fine in the west, partly cloudy to cloudy, cool to warm, scattered showers in the east.
  • Western Half of the Eastern Cape: Cloudy, cold with scattered showers, widespread along the coast.
  • Eastern Half of the Eastern Cape: Cloudy, cold, widespread showers and thundershowers.
  • KwaZulu-Natal: Cloudy, cool, widespread showers and thundershowers, scattered in the northeast.
